Output 5d19071bb6da35c8caadba30d23923f5915b634e36cbb1ff15b5daf7dac13f81:205

value
31780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b87fdfc29d853d61f8623a4e923012f33b8ab20 OP_EQUAL
address
38aPWq5ihiBdnBUmvGVA7JT1LkSW1HdGSs
transaction
5d19071bb6da35c8caadba30d23923f5915b634e36cbb1ff15b5daf7dac13f81
confirmations
170461
spent
true